BASIC S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
1.3 Electrical connection
DANGER
Voltage at the terminals and in the device!
Danger to life due to electric shock!
For any work on the unit switch o󰀨 the supply voltage and secure it
against switching on.
Wait until the drive has stopped in order, that perhaps regenerative
energy can be generated.
Wait untill the DC-Link capacitors are discharged (5 minutes). Verify
by measuring the DC voltage at the terminals.
Never bridge upstream protective devices (also not for test purpos-
es).
For a trouble-free and safe operation, please pay attention to the following instructions:
The electrical installation shall be carried out in accordance with the relevant
requirements.
Cable cross-sections and fuses must be dimensioned by the user accordly to the
specied minimum / maximum values for the operation.
Within systems or machines the person installing electrical wiring must ensure
that on existing or new wired safe ELV circuits the EN requirement for safe insula-
tion is still met!
For drive converters that are not isolated from the supply circuit (in accordance
with EN 61800-5-1) all control lines must be included in other protective measures
(e.g. double insulation or shielded, earthed and insulated).
When using components without isolated inputs/outputs, it is necessary that equi-
potential bonding exists between the components to be connected (e.g. by the
equipotential line). Disregard can cause destruction of the components by equal-
izing currents.
1.4 Start-up and operation
The start-up (i.e. for the specied application) is forbidden until it is determined that the
installation complies with the machine directive; account is to be taken of EN 60204-1.
WARNING
Software protection and programming!
Hazards caused by unintentional behavior of the drive!
Check especially during initial start-up or replacement of the drive
controller if parameterization is compatible to application.
Securing a unit solely with software-supported functions is not suf-
cient. It is imperative to install external protective measures (e.g.
limit switch) that are independent of the drive controller.
Secure motors against automatic restart.
